How Our Concrete Slab Water Extraction Process Works
Our team follows a strict process to ensure your Concrete Slab Water Extraction is done right the first time. We start by ass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to get your property back to normal. Our technicians use state-of-the-art equipment to extract water from the slab, and we work quickly to reduce downtime.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your property back to normal. Our technicians will identify the source of the water and develop a strategy to extract it safely and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water from the slab, including truck-mounted extractors and portable pumps. We’ll work quickly to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to ensure your property is completely dry.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ize the area to prevent any further damage or health risks. This includes disinfecting surfaces and removing any remaining water or debris.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is completely restored to its original condition. We’ll make any necessary repairs and provide a thorough cleaning to get your property back to normal.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on the slab | Yes | No | DIY with a wet v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ract water and prevent mold growth. |
| Slab water damage from a natural flood |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ract water and prevent further damage. |
| Water stains on the ceiling | No | Yes | Professional inspection and repair are needed to prevent further damage.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| Professional repair and restoration are needed to fix the damage. |
| Visible water damage on walls | No | Yes | Professional inspection and repair are needed to prevent further damage. |

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ost in Aberdeen, WA
The cost of Concrete Slab Water Extraction in Aberdeen, WA can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of the damage and the equipment needed to extract the water.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Dehumidification and drying | $300 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Final inspection and restoration | $100 – $300 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Equipment rental fees |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ental and equipment type. |
